Introduction to MC4 Connectors

MC4 connectors are a type of electrical connector used extensively in photovoltaic systems, including solar panels. They are designed to provide a safe, efficient, and reliable connection between solar panels and other components of the system, such as inverters or chargers. These connectors are favored for their simplicity, durability, and the fact that they can withstand various environmental conditions, including exposure to water and extreme temperatures.

Design and Functionality

The design of MC4 connectors includes a locking mechanism that ensures a secure connection, preventing accidental disconnections due to vibration or pulling forces. They are typically made from high-quality, UV-resistant materials to ensure longevity, even when exposed to direct sunlight for extended periods. The connectors are designed to be used with single-wire cables, making them straightforward to install and maintain.

Risks Associated with Cutting MC4 Connectors

Cutting off MC4 connectors can introduce several risks into your electrical system:
Safety Hazards: Exposed wires can lead to electrical shocks or fires, especially if not properly insulated or protected.
System Efficiency: Altering the connectors can affect the system’s overall efficiency and performance, potentially leading to reduced power output or increased energy loss.
Warranty and Compliance Issues: Modifying connectors may void the manufacturer’s warranty or lead to non-compliance with electrical standards and regulations.

Alternatives to Cutting MC4 Connectors

Before deciding to cut off MC4 connectors, consider the following alternatives:
Using Adapter Cables: If the issue is compatibility, using adapter cables specifically designed for MC4 connectors can be a viable solution.
Replacing the Connectors: If the connectors are damaged, replacing them with new ones might be more straightforward and safer than cutting them off.
Consulting Professionals: For complex issues or when in doubt, consulting with electrical or solar panel installation professionals can provide tailored solutions that minimize risks.
